"We Like to Party" is a popular 1998 electronica dance song by Dutch music group the Vengaboys. It is played in A-flat major. The song became their biggest hit in the United States, peaking at #26 in the Top 30 of the Billboard Hot 100 and selling 405,000 copies.

The song was also remixed by Jason Nevins and Tin-Tin Out. Their mixes were included on the single for "We're Going to Ibiza!"

Covers and cultural references

*It was used as a remix in the Crazy Frog album "Crazy Frog Presents Crazy Hits" but instead of saying "The Vengabus is coming" it is heard as "The Crazy Frog is coming".
*It is well-known for its use in the Six Flags "It's Playtime!" advertising campaign, and was the theme of the Mr. Six character.
*In the beginning of the song, the first three lines are almost the same to Billy Ocean's top hit "When the Going Gets Tough, the Tough Get Going".
*The song was used by Philadelphia Phillies second baseman Chase Utley, and inspired his traveling fan group "The Vengabus".
*An incorrect version of the song, as sung by Richard Marsland was used as a running gag on Australian radio show "Get This" for most of 2007.
